Output 31cba798596ac523686382a7ba528b1e3031a4087c401207aeac48ffffee8261:11

value
637400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952f5fb24ae7f07def8f513901c1e3521c7e2a55 OP_EQUAL
address
3FHqMiXbUvWoBwkYZZiKe6X2XXH149j29C
transaction
31cba798596ac523686382a7ba528b1e3031a4087c401207aeac48ffffee8261
spent
true